Experience elevated downtown living at Nobu Residences in this stunning 2-bedroom, 2-bathroom corner suite with spectacular south-east views of the CN Tower, Rogers Centre, city skyline, and Lake Ontario. Designed with style and functionality in mind, this bright and spacious unit features 9-foot ceilings, floor-to-ceiling windows, and an open-concept layout filled with natural light. The modern kitchen showcases quartz countertops, premium Miele appliances, and sleek contemporary finishes. Additional features include custom window coverings, in-suite laundry, and thoughtfully selected fixtures throughout. Residents enjoy luxury hotel-inspired living with a 24-hour concierge and premium amenities. Ideally situated in Toronto's vibrant Entertainment District, steps to world-class dining, shopping, theatres, and nightlife, with convenient access to transit, the Financial District, and the waterfront. Entertainment District,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, university grads, executives and business, science, education, law & public sector and arts & culture professionals.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of youth aged 20 to 24 and adults aged 25 to 44.
